Onboarding: Paperlark renders invoices to PDF via the Quillbend template engine. Clone the repo, run the fixture suite, and confirm kerning output matches the golden files. Staging jobs queue through the Tindery broker. Before your first render, register the worker with the Tindery admin API using the key that follows.

app token of badug-tahaf = qvz11-nP5FBNr8qnh

## Local Setup — Farevane Rules Engine

Farevane evaluates shipping-fee rules per order at checkout. Clone the repo, install dependencies, and copy the sample config into your workspace. Rules are loaded from the pricing database at startup, so the service won't boot without a valid connection. For local development, use the following connection string.

replica DSN, yahog-kawig: redis://istox_svc:um@db-8a67.halixforge.test:5432/frawyn

Subject: Key rotation for InvoiceForge renderer

Welcome, new folks. Every quarter we rotate the credential the Pellworth PDF invoice renderer uses to call our internal asset service, Vaultline. The old key stops working Friday at noon. Update your local .env and the staging config before then, and verify a test invoice renders with the new embedded fonts. For convenience, the freshly issued key is included here.

app token of bagef-bageg = kto11_vuwA0uhrEMg

Audit item 14 — sort stability in the Brindlewood report builder. Quick check before you approve: confirm the grid uses a stable sort when users stack multiple column orderings, since the old quicksort path shuffled ties and confused finance. Verify the regression test with duplicate keys actually runs in CI. Any doubts, escalate straight to the person named below.

account owner for bawip-tahag: Raleth Quenok

Internal Memo — FY Headcount Plan

For the incoming director: next year's plan adds 14 roles — eight in engineering at the Braxton site, four in customer success, two in compliance. Net growth 7% after attrition. Backfill approvals route through the talent committee; freezes apply only to the Selwyn program. Budget is locked pending board sign-off in December. One strategic note is appended below for your eyes.

management briefing: Project Ulavan slips by two quarters because of the staffing delay.